HI -----I'm looking to buy in Central Florida and would consider an older double wide if I could add the required tie downs or anchors. Can anyone give me a ball park figure on what the cost would be per anchor or for a 1200 to 1500 ft double wide?

Generally when I tie down a home, I figure about $35 per anchor for material, and $35 per anchor for labor. Of course this is assuming your drilling into normal soil. Go down to the Keys where it's all rock, then labor will skyrocket.
